Sighting for July 19, 2021
David L. Amadio
PA SGL#57
Wyoming County, PA
- Eastern Tiger Swallowtail 3
- Canadian Tiger Swallowtail 2
- Cabbage White 5
- Clouded Sulphur 2
- Orange Sulphur 4
- Striped Hairstreak 5
- Eastern Tailed-Blue 3
- 'Summer' Spring Azure 7
- Great Spangled Fritillary 13
- Aphrodite Fritillary 1
- Atlantis Fritillary 12
- Pearl Crescent 8
- Mourning Cloak 1
- Milbert's Tortoiseshell 1
- American Lady 3
- Northern Pearly-eye 3
- Eyed Brown 5
- Common Wood-Nymph 5
- Monarch 8
- Silver-spotted Skipper 1
- Peck's Skipper 6
- Long Dash 10
- Northern Broken-Dash 1
- Little Glassywing 2
- Delaware Skipper 7
- Dion Skipper 4
- Black Dash 1
- Two-spotted Skipper 1
- Dun Skipper 13
Obs. made from 12:10 and 4 p.m. part sun changing to mostly cloudy with a brief shower at 3:30. Temps reached about 80. Had a brief encounter with a fresh Milbert’s Tortoiseshell just before the rain shower. Tiger Swallowtail numbers extremely low for this location. Besides those posted I had 2 or 3 additional ones not conclusive as to Eastern v.s. Canadian. Silver-spotted Skipper would prove to be the only spread winged skipper observed today.
